How Much Is 54.67 Grams of Buttermilk in Fluid Ounces?

54.67 grams of buttermilk equals 1.79 fl oz. Buttermilk has a density of 245g per cup. Because grams measure weight and fluid ounces measure volume, the result depends on the ingredient's density.

Formula and Step-by-Step

grams ÷ 245g/cup × 8 = fluid ounces
  1. Start with 54.67 grams of buttermilk
  2. 1 cup of buttermilk = 245g
  3. 54.67g ÷ 245g/cup = 0.22 cups × 8 = 1.79 fluid ounces

The same formula works for any amount. Multiply (or divide) by the density, then convert units as needed.

Measuring Tip

Liquid densities vary: oils weigh less per cup than water, while syrups and honey weigh more. This is why ingredient-specific conversions matter even for liquids.

Understanding the Units

What is a Gram?

Weighing ingredients in grams eliminates the variability of volume measurements. A cup of flour can weigh anywhere from 120g to 160g depending on how it was scooped, but 120g of flour is always 120g of flour.

What is a Fluid Ounce?

Fluid ounces measure how much space a liquid takes up, while ounces (oz) measure weight. 1 fluid ounce of water weighs close to 1 oz, but for other liquids like honey or oil, the weight per fluid ounce is different.
